Meet Jay Garrick In New Promo For The Flash Season 2

The CW has released a new promo for season two of The Flash, and it features plenty of new footage from the series, including a first look at Jay Garrick.

The CW has yet to release a full-length trailer for season two of The Flash, but yet another brief new promo has found its way online today. It’s the most revealing one yet, too, as we get to see Jay Garrick – The Flash from Earth-2 – for the very first time. As you can see above, he warns Barry Allen about the fact that the Singularity has opened the door between the two worlds, and one of those to come through that is the villainous Atom-Smasher.

While the first season of The Flash dealt with metahumans, it appears as if many of the villains who will be featured on the second are set to hail from Earth-2. It’s thought that will also be the case for new big bad Zoom, a character whose identity is being kept a secret for the time being (he’s Hunter Zolomon in the comics, but there may be some sort of twist in the show according to its producers). For now, he’ll be voiced by Tony Todd.

The Flash returns to The CW on October 6th with “The Man Who Saved Central City.” Will you be tuning in? Sound off below and let us know.
